Each couple faces unique challenges since no two marriages are the same. Since each couple may have a range of issues, we break them down into categories, so it is easier to manage for all involved. Depending on your marriage, the categories might include child support, child custody, property division, and alimony. Even though there are differences in every case, there are state standards to consider for each topic.
When you enter a marriage, you may enter with your property, as will your spouse. During your marriage, you will likely acquire other assets and property considered marital property. A prenup will often cover any property or assets brought into the marriage but may lack in addressing marital property. If there is no prenuptial agreement, the court will distribute the property equitably. Distributing property equitably means it is equal and fair.
Regarding separate property, upon divorce, this will still be individual property. A Dayton divorce lawyer will be able to look at all factors and determine how to divide the property. One caveat is that the separate property may become marital property as the years have gone by.
When you enter a marriage, you become accustomed to a certain standard of living. You may have even quit your job or changed careers to care for the needs of the family and the home. Alimony will bridge the financial gap that a divorce may cause. Depending on your case, you can obtain child support for a short or extended period.
Issues related to children are often the most contentious topics in any divorce or separation. If you had children, you must now determine where they will be spending their time and how each parent will contribute financially. In most cases, one party will be the custodial parent, and the court will give the other a visitation schedule. Next, you will need to determine child support payments.
